I have been disappointed to find out that Adobe Digital Editions does not recognize the PRS-T3.
Have you registered the device with Adobe? You can do this with the T3's web browser and Wifi switched on directly (I had, however, the impression that the Reader software initially scanned my PC and transferred the Adobe ID to the T3). Then you can copy books via USB cable from the directory where ADE stores the downloaded books to the reader (or import them via the Reader software). AFAIK ADE doesn't recognise the reader as connected device.
